For the purposes of this chapter, the following words and phrases shall have the meanings respectively ascribed to them by this section:
CELLAR
The lowest story of any building, dwelling or tenement house of which 1/3 or more of the height from the floor to the ceiling is below ground level.
MULTIFAMILY DWELLING
Includes every house, building or portion thereof which is rented, leased, let or hired out to be occupied or is occupied as a house, home or residence by three or more families living independently of one another and having facilities for doing their cooking and sleeping upon the premises.
PROPERTY and PREMISES
Unless restricted or limited by the context to either real or personal property, they shall include both.
SINGLE-FAMILY DWELLING
Includes every house or a portion thereof which is rented, leased, let or hired out to be occupied as a house, home or residence of one family, be there one or more persons living therein and having facilities for doing their cooking and sleeping upon the premises.

TENANT
Any person occupying any house, building or portion thereof which is rented, leased, let or hired out to be occupied as a house, residence or a business establishment.
TWO-FAMILY DWELLING
Includes every house or a portion thereof which is rented, leased, let or hired out to be occupied as a house, home or residence by two families living independently of one another and having facilities for doing their cooking and sleeping upon the premises.
